In a case-control study of oral cancer, investigators individually match each case with a control on the basis of tobacco chewing status, intending to strengthen the study. A major consequence of this choice is that the study:
- A Will automatically show a stronger odds ratio for tobacco chewing
- B Cannot estimate the independent effect of tobacco chewing on oral cancer risk ✓
- C Becomes immune to recall bias regarding past tobacco use
- D Must be analysed using unconditional logistic regression
Explanation
Once cases and controls are matched on a variable, its distribution is forced to be identical in both groups, so no information about its association with disease remains in the data. The matched factor can be examined only if the matching is broken or the design allows discordant pairs to be modelled separately. Overmatching on a factor closely linked to the exposure can also bias the odds ratio toward the null.
